Compare all specifications:
2001 Hyundai Matrix | 1998 Volkswagen Golf | |
Make | Hyundai | Volkswagen |
Model | Matrix | Golf |
Year Released | 2001 | 1998 |
Body Type | Minivan |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1495 cc | 1983 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 3 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 81 HP | 114 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Torque | 183 Nm | 170 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1900 RPM | 2400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 83.1 mm | 82.6 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 92 mm | 92.8 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 18.0:1 | 10.5:1 |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1290 kg | 1292 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4030 mm | 4160 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1740 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1640 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2610 mm | 2520 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 62 L |
